About the company

Brenntag SE is a Germany-based company active in the fields of chemicals and ingredients distribution. The Company offers a broad product range comprising more than 20,000 chemicals and ingredients as well as services such as just-in-time delivery, product mixing, repackaging, inventory management and drum return handling. It also offers tailor-made application, marketing and supply chain solutions, technical and formulation support, comprehensive regulatory know-how and digital solutions such as digital sales channels and product platforms. The Company manages its business through two global divisions: Brenntag Specialties focuses on selling ingredients and value-added services, and it focuses on industries Nutrition, Pharma, Personal Care/Home, Industrial & Institutional, Material Science (Coatings & Construction, Polymers, Rubber), Water Treatment and Lubricants. Brenntag Essentials markets a broad portfolio of process chemicals across a wide range of industries and applications.
